Jump to content

    
Sign in to follow this  
AlexZabr

Run програм в CCS 3.3 без подключенного DSK борта

Recommended Posts

Есть ли возможность запускать программу в CCS ver. 3.3 без подключенного борта ?

Пишу код под C5402 в недавно скаченной CCS 3.3. Я в этом новичок.

CCS сконфигурировал на С5402 Simulator.

 

Судя по описанию, для Runа программы (после успешного Build All ессно) - опязательно загрузить .out в подключенный борд (которого у меня пока нет) и тогда можно делать Run - будет бежать из процессора.

А что-же тогда симулятор ? Неужели нельзя запускать программы в режиме симуляции, т.е. без подключенного hardware ?

Если можно, то как ? МОжет нужно как-то еще сконфигурировать CCS ?

 

Спасибо, Саша

Share this post


Link to post
Share on other sites
Судя по описанию, для Runа программы (после успешного Build All ессно) - обязательно загрузить .out в подключенный борд (которого у меня пока нет)

....или в Simulator (ели в утилите Setup вы указали его, а при запуске CCS выбрали соответствующую сессию (при налилии больше чем одной конфигурации в Setup))

Share this post


Link to post
Share on other sites

В симуляторе подключенный борд это и есть то, что собственно дает симулятор. И в него, в симулируемый борд, грузится программа (File->Load program)

Share this post


Link to post
Share on other sites

так там и сама поддержка семейства С2000 отсутствовала - в первую очередь в 3.2b обкатывались тузлы для С64+ и С67+ (ИМХО)

 

в 3.3 поддержка С2000 наличествует

Share this post


Link to post
Share on other sites
господа, а есть ли в CCS 3.3 симулятор для 2000-й серии. В 3.2 почему то отсутствовал...

В 3.2 не так, чтобы отсутствовал, просто был закопан чуть поглубже. Через "Import..." все доступно.

Share this post


Link to post
Share on other sites
простите ошибся - установлена 3.1

 

а что импортировать? может и у меня это симулятор есть, или скажите откуда скачать.

Ну в 3.1 должно нативно все быть. Но если нет, то запускаем Setup CCStudio (cc_setup.exe), жмем File -> Import... -> Browse... и выбираем либо c27xx_sim.ccs, либо f28xx_sim.ccs, либо f28xx_simtut.ccs, либо f2810_sim.ccs, либо f2811_sim.ccs... В общем этот список можно продолжать бесконечно -- все зависит от наших (точнее, ваших) предпочтений. Жмем Ок и -- вуаля!

 

P.S. Блин... Во всех топиках пишу одно и то же. Когда общественность уже осознает наконец, что версия 3.2 вовсе не такая ущербная, каковой ее пытаются представить техасские инструменты... Вон 3.3 даже ущербнее оказалась (в плане поддержки DSK5402).

Share this post


Link to post
Share on other sites
Ну в 3.1 должно нативно все быть. Но если нет, то запускаем Setup CCStudio (cc_setup.exe), жмем File -> Import... -> Browse... и выбираем либо c27xx_sim.ccs, либо f28xx_sim.ccs, либо f28xx_simtut.ccs, либо f2810_sim.ccs, либо f2811_sim.ccs... В общем этот список можно продолжать бесконечно -- все зависит от наших (точнее, ваших) предпочтений. Жмем Ок и -- вуаля!

 

P.S. Блин... Во всех топиках пишу одно и то же. Когда общественность уже осознает наконец, что версия 3.2 вовсе не такая ущербная, каковой ее пытаются представить техасские инструменты... Вон 3.3 даже ущербнее оказалась (в плане поддержки DSK5402).

 

Хмм, :) , ну я не уверен можно ли это считать ущербностью. Отказ от поддержки в 3.3 сего DSK был принципиальным решением TIя, не ошибкой, багом или недосмотром. Вполне вероятно что в 3.3 он все-таки поддерживается через XDS510 адаптер (USB - JTAG), что обойдется в 1500$ при покупке с сайта TIя...

Хотя я считаю это решение неправельным (IMHO ессно) ибо в свео время 5402 видимо был фундаментальным DSP чипом на котором очень много что делалось и мног универов базировали свои DSP лабы с этими DSK, и вот теперь фактически эти универы должны либо раскошеливаться на новые системы, либо забить на обновление софта и стоять еще годы на версиях софта 5-6 летней давности и более...

Share this post


Link to post
Share on other sites
Ну в 3.1 должно нативно все быть. Но если нет, то запускаем Setup CCStudio (cc_setup.exe), жмем File -> Import... -> Browse... и выбираем либо c27xx_sim.ccs, либо f28xx_sim.ccs, либо f28xx_simtut.ccs, либо f2810_sim.ccs, либо f2811_sim.ccs...

ну да, я опять забыл, что в С2000 есть еще и 28-я серия. Мне нужно симулировать LF2407...

Share this post


Link to post
Share on other sites
ну да, я опять забыл, что в С2000 есть еще и 28-я серия. Мне нужно симулировать LF2407...

На 24-е семейство я не нашел симуляторов ни в 3.1, ни в 3.2, ни в 3.3 :(

Share this post


Link to post
Share on other sites

Тогда отвечу на ваш вопрос...

господа, а есть ли в CCS 3.3 симулятор для 2000-й серии. В 3.2 почему то отсутствовал...

Если под 2000-ной серией понимать семейство 24x, то нет.

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Sign in to follow this